Overview of Airline IoT Market
The airline industry has undergone rapid transformation in recent years, with IoT (Internet of Things) emerging as a game-changing technology. From predictive maintenance and real-time monitoring to enhancing in-flight entertainment, IoT has enabled airlines to reduce costs, improve operational efficiency, and deliver personalized passenger experiences. The Airline IoT Market is witnessing growth due to increasing demand for smart aviation solutions, digital transformation initiatives, and the rising need for data-driven insights in airline operations.

Market Segmentation
The Airline IoT Market is segmented into Component and Application categories, each driving innovation and creating opportunities across the aviation sector.
- Component:
- Devices – Sensors, tracking devices, and connected systems that enable data collection and analysis.
- Software – Platforms for predictive analytics, data visualization, and system management.
- Data Center Systems – Infrastructure for real-time data storage and management.
- IT Services – Implementation, consulting, and integration services.
- Communication Services – Connectivity solutions, satellite systems, and wireless communication networks.
- Application:
- In-flight Entertainment and Connectivity – Enhanced passenger experiences through high-speed internet and smart entertainment systems.
- Fuel Management and Energy Savings – IoT-enabled optimization of fuel consumption and energy efficiency.
- Predictive Maintenance and Vehicle Diagnostics – Proactive monitoring of aircraft health to reduce downtime and improve safety.
- Engine Performance Optimization – Real-time engine monitoring and performance enhancements.
Spotting Emerging Trends
- Technological Advancements: The adoption of AI-powered IoT platforms, edge computing, and cloud-based analytics is reshaping airline operations. Predictive algorithms and machine learning enhance decision-making, while IoT-driven automation enables real-time updates on aircraft performance, passenger needs, and safety protocols.
- Changing Consumer Preferences: Passengers now demand personalized travel experiences, seamless connectivity, and interactive entertainment. Airlines are leveraging IoT to track passenger behaviors, improve loyalty programs, and deliver customized services, ensuring greater customer satisfaction and retention.
- Regulatory Changes: Governments and aviation authorities are enforcing stricter regulations related to data security, cybersecurity, and operational safety. IoT implementation in airlines must comply with evolving aviation guidelines to ensure secure and reliable digital ecosystems.
